Yellowstone Snowmobile Tours Allow Winter Visitors To Appreciate The Region

Yellowstone snowmobile tours help visitors enjoy winter recreation and wildlife. A snowmobiling tour of Yellowstone can be a great way to see the park's vast herds of native wildlife. Snowmobile tours can help people enjoy winter recreation and experience "America's Serengetti". Elk, bison and other large mammals make snowmobiling here a real treat.

Snowmobile tours can be arranged from various locations. The most popular include West Yellowstone and Cooke City. West Yellowstone allows access to the Old Faithful area. Cooke City is closer to the Lamar Valley, although the road into the Lamar Valley area is open for cars, so snowmobiling around Cooke City is usually in the forest land adjacent to Yellowstone Park.

Cooke City also allows easy car access to the Lamar Valley. This is the prime destination in the park during the winter months for wildlife watching. Gray wolves, which were reintroduced to Yellowstone Park about twenty years ago, are often viewed here. In addition, wildlife watchers can see herds of elk, bison and pronghorn antelope. The rivers are a good place to look for river otters and bald eagles.

... cover can be thick even into May, so conditions are ideal for several months each year. Visitors should prepare for rapidly changing an unpredictable weather however. Even in the spring, nice weather can yield to blizzard conditions rather quickly and often with little warning. Spring is often the best time to enjoy nice weather and good snow conditions, but the weather can still be very winter like even into May.

This region is used to plenty of snow. The Beartooth Highway that runs to the Northeast entrance of the park from Red Lodge, Montana rises to an elevation over 10,000 feet and the highway does not open in the spring until Memorial Day because of deep snow. However, the Northeast entrance can be reached via Gardiner and Mammoth to the west.

In mid-winter temperatures can get bitterly cold. Below zero weather is common in the months of December, January and February. Visitors are advised to dress warm and to be prepared for many different weather conditions, including dangerous wind chill factors and low visibility from blowing snow. For this reason it is good to dress warm and travel with a group of people so that should you require medical attention somebody is around to assist you.

Many companies provide guided tours for snowmobiling. Some may even offer snowmobile rentals. If you do travel into the park on a snowmobile, be sure to stay of designated routes and always yield for wildlife. Approaching and harassing wildlife is illegal and can stress out the animals needlessly. It is also unlawful to snowmobile off of established roads and trails in the national park.

Yellowstone snowmobile tours are a wonderful way to enjoy America's oldest national park. The winter crowds are a fraction of the summer crowd, so you may have much of the area to your self. The winter scenery is considered by many to be even more spectacular than the summer views, because the snow accents the mountain peaks and highlights the region's wildlife.
